Seven inches equals about 17.78 centimeters, which is less than 18 cm. It’s 0.583 feet or about 177.8 millimeters.
Looking at your hand can give you a quick measurement of 7 inches is a bit less than the length from your wrist to the tip of your middle finger for an average adult.

Two Credit Cards

If you place two standard credit cards end-to-end, they’ll measure 7 inches.
Each card is about 3.37 inches long, so together gives you around 6.74 inches which is around 7 inches. It’s like having a built-in ruler.
This reference is handy because many people carry credit cards, making it an easy measurement tool.

Salad Plates

The diameter of a standard salad plate is around 7 inches across.
Dinner plates are around 10-12 inches, while the small plates used for salads, desserts, or appetizers are around 7-inch.
This makes them a perfect household reference for visualizing this measurement.
